Picking the Perfect Steak Cut
Choosing the right steak can make your Alfredo dish amazing. Look for tender cuts that go well with the creamy sauce:
- Ribeye: Marbled and flavorful
- Filet Mignon: Extremely tender
- New York Strip: Balanced flavor and texture

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ions and Expert Tips
Making the perfect Steak Alfredo Recipe needs care and love. Begin by getting your ingredients ready. Season a top-notch cut of beef with kosher salt and fresh ground pepper. This ensures every bite is full of flavor.
Cooking the steak is all about paying attention. Heat a cast-iron skillet to high and sear the meat for 3-4 minutes on each side. If you prefer, a grilled chicken breast is a great substitute.
- Pat the steak dry before seasoning
- Use high-heat cooking oil like avocado or grapeseed
- Allow meat to rest for 5-7 minutes after cooking
The creamy Alfredo sauce is the dish’s soul. Melt butter in a saucepan, then whisk in heavy cream. Slowly add freshly grated Parmesan cheese. Keep stirring to avoid burning and get a smooth sauce.
To add a special touch, sprinkle crispy garlic bread crumbs on top. They bring a nice crunch and improve the dish’s texture.
Pro tip: Always slice the steak against the grain for maximum tenderness!
Finish by placing sliced steak over cooked pasta, then pour the warm Alfredo sauce over it. You’ll have a meal that rivals a restaurant’s, all made in your kitchen.

Fresh Ingredients You’ll Need
- 1 lb ribeye or sirloin steak
- 16 oz fettuccine pasta
- 2 cups heavy cream
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 tbsp butter
- Salt and black pepper to taste
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
- Season steak with salt and pepper
- Sear steak in hot skillet for 3-4 minutes per side
- Remove steak, let rest while preparing one-pot pasta
- In same skillet, create creamy Alfredo sauce
- Cook pasta directly in sauce until al dente
- Slice steak, place on top of pasta
- Garnish with fresh basil and extra Parmesan
